How to Disable Snap Assist in Windows 10

Snapping windows is a great feature. Drag a window to the corner or side of your screen and Windows automatically resizes it to fill that space. When you snap a window to one side of the screen, Windows presents a thumbnail view of other open windows that you can use to fill the other half. That’s Snap Assist and if you don’t like it, you can turn it off.
